Designer Rodolfo Bonetto made his Quattro Quarti 4/4 occasional coffee table set from four identical sections that can be used as an end table, a coffee table and one left over for next to your favorite chair. This versatile and practical table made of injection molded ABS plastic which is extremely durable and can even be stacked on top of each other to create a modular bookcase. 40" Diameter 11.8' H Available Here $1200



Brian Law and Tan Sixiu are designers from Singapore who have collaborated in a project called CRISP that created these cool accent tables and chairs. Tan Sixiu is currently a design student in her final year at the University of Singapore. Brian Law graduated from the same institution in 2006 and is rising in the design community. Inspiration for the chair designs was drawn from the human form as it might engage in conversation in a living room social setting. If you can imagine a group of people sitting together in different positions in a living room, various parts of their shapes blend to create the shapes of these chairs. Via.

Nurai is an exclusive island resort design project in Abu Dhabi. Perhaps, lesser known than the nearby city of Dubai, there is lots of speculation that Abu Dhabi is the richest city in the world. Nurai is the architectural vision of Zaya LLC which plans to bring together the best elements of resort, island, and beach living.
